Integrating Nutrition Into Practice: Nutrients, Supplements & Therapeutic Diets is organized by American Nutrition Association® (ANA).

Description:
Elevate your expertise in nutrients, supplements, and therapeutic diets with our advanced training program tailored for medical professionals. This advanced training program equips you with the knowledge and skills to identify patients at risk of drug and nutrient interactions and navigate the complexities of botanicals and nutraceuticals, so you can begin to provide optimal patient care through personalized nutrition interventions.
This is the third course in the Integrating Nutrition into Practice series. Completion of all twelve courses meets the eligibility requirements to sit for the Certified Personalized Nutrition Practitioner examination.

Participants will:
• Describe the difference between sufficient nutrient intake and optimal nutrition status
• List factors that impact nutrient status and apply clinical interventions to optimize nutrient status
• Identify patients/clients who may benefit from common botanicals and provide clinical advice regarding the use of botantically generally
• Distinguish between drug-induced nutrition depletions, drug-nutrient interactions, and nutrient-nutrient interactions
• Recommend strategies to mitigate undesired effects of nutritional deficiences caused by drug-nutrient or nutrient-nutrient interactions
